What is a Manual Planing Machine?
A manual planing machine is a tool utilized in woodworking to lower the thickness of wood and develop a smooth surface. Unlike automated planers, which are powered by electrical energy, manual planers depend on the physical force used by the operator. While these machines might require more effort, they use a number of benefits, including much better control and lower operating expense.

Q2: How often do I need to hone the blades?
This depends upon the frequency of use and the kind of wood being worked with. Typically, it's advisable to sharpen the blades after every heavy usage or when you discover a decrease in cutting effectiveness.
Q3: Can I utilize a manual aircraft on hardwood?
Yes, manual planers can be used on hardwoods, however guarantee that the blades are sharp sufficient to manage the density of the product without triggering damage.
Q4: Are there security considerations I should remember?
Always make certain to use proper hand strategies, preserve a tidy working location, and make sure that the blade is appropriately set to lower risks of injury.
Q5: How can I maintain my manual planing machine?
Keep the blade sharp, tidy the body of the aircraft frequently, and store it in a dry place to avoid rusting. Periodically check the parts for wear and replace as required.
